For robust image processing in Java, JDeli stands out as an Aspose alternative, offering powerful features for various imaging tasks. Both offer powerful features for reading, writing, converting, and manipulating images, we will look at their key differences.

However, their strengths, supported formats, and ideal use cases different. Here’s a detailed comparison to help you decide which is best for your project.

Supported Platforms and Ecosystem


The Aspose.Imaging Java library, is targeted towards Java developers working with a wide range of image formats. Though they also offer APIs to target the .NET Framework, both are aimed to reduce the need for complex image editors.

Format Support


Both libraries support a wide range of image formats, including common ones like JPEG, PNG, BMP, TIFF, and GIF. Though the features is where you will start to see a difference.

Core Features and Processing Capabilities


Aspose.Imaging offers extensive image processing features, including format conversion, compression, resizing, cropping, rotating, flipping, deskewing, photo collage and album creation, animation, and advanced drawing operations such as shapes, vector graphics, and matrix transformations.

JDeli provides comprehensive manipulation tool like watermarking, thumbnail generation, blurring, brightening, cropping, embossing, and mirroring. JDeli is known for its performance, especially with formats like PNG, BMP, TIFF, and JPEG2000, and for reducing read times significantly compared to other Java libraries.

Ease of Integration and Support


JDeli is easy to integrate into existing Java codebases. Developers can replace ImageIO.read and ImageIO.write with JDeli equivalents or use its plugin for seamless migration. It requires no third-party dependencies and no code changes, also reducing potential security issues.

Aspose.Imaging provides a rich API for Java developers for several use cases, from basic image manipulation to complex drawing and data recovery tasks. However there have been noted instances where (due to lack of documentation) developers faced integration issues with platforms like Appian, leading to slow onboarding.

Licensing and Commercial Support


Both libraries are commercial products with relevant support teams. JDeli is noted for its direct, developer-focused support and rapid turnaround on bug fixes. Aspose offers a broad suite of imaging and document solutions, making it attractive for organizations needing an all-in-one toolkit.

Aspose uses a tiered, per-developer or site annual subscription model with separate pricing for each product and platform, often requiring quotes for bundles and extra support. The complex pricing model makes it difficult for developers evaluate the value of the library.

As an aspose alternative, JDeli offers three tier annual licenses priced per server or distributed application, with clear flat rates and included priority support.
